Course structure

• Foundations of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T)
• Psychological Flexibility and Self-Compassion
• Mindfulness Practices for Self-Care
• Values Clarification and Goal Setting
• Defusion Techniques for Managing Thoughts
• Committed Action and Behavioral Change
• ACT for Stress, Anxiety, and Burnout
• Integrating ACT into Daily Self-Care Routines
• Ethical Considerations in ACT Practice
• Case Studies and Practical Applications of ACT

The Postgraduate Certificate in Acceptance and Commitment Techniques (ACT) for Self-care is increasingly significant in today’s market, particularly in the UK, where mental health and well-being are critical priorities. According to the Mental Health Foundation, 74% of UK adults have felt overwhelmed or unable to cope due to stress, highlighting the urgent need for effective self-care strategies. ACT, a mindfulness-based approach, equips professionals with tools to manage stress, enhance resilience, and improve emotional well-being, making it highly relevant in both personal and professional contexts. The demand for ACT-trained professionals is rising, with the UK’s mental health services sector growing by 5.2% annually. This growth underscores the importance of upskilling in evidence-based techniques like ACT, which align with current trends in workplace well-being and mental health support. Employers are increasingly valuing staff trained in ACT, as it fosters productivity, reduces burnout, and promotes a healthier work environment.
